From the new OPM

Hirai - That was a prototype. Kutaragi-san ran tall order past the designers. We've had two consoles, basically same design. So we want a fresh approach. We're going to look at form factor, but it has got to feel familiar. It's a difficult balance. But it's definitely a work in progress. We want to make sure when it's in your hands, it's familiar.
